Some leaders of the United States have had a major impact on the way Americans celebrate Thanksgiving today

1 Answer

1 vote

"George Washington, John Adams and James Madison all issued proclamations urging Americans to observe days of thanksgiving, both for general good fortune and for particularly momentous events (the adoption of the U.S. Constitution, in Washington’s case; the end of the War of 1812, in Madison’s). "
